Why We Like It
LED masks pair specific wavelengths with a timed session, usually 10 to 20 minutes. They are a slow-burn gadget: consistent use over weeks matters far more than any single session. Turns a skincare add-on into a set-and-forget habit. Hands-free, so it fits around real life.
What It Does
Hands-free red-light sessions you can run while you scroll. When you shop for one, focus on published wavelengths and session length, regulatory clearance where you live and eye protection and a comfortable strap.
